Today’s General Hospital recap for October 25, 2023, details Michael’s move to control his wife’s life, Liesl returning to PC, Sasha staying in PC, and Ava and Trina having a heart-to-heart.
Michael Plays Dirty
General Hospital – Michael and Nina
Nina (Cynthia Watros) was surprised when Michael (Chad Duell) arrived at her office but she put on a friendly face, inviting him and Willow (Katelyn MacMullen) back to Sonny’s (Maurice Benard) island for an extended stay. Nina finally realized something was wrong when Michael told her that his family wouldn’t be spending much time with her in the future.
Nina was confused over Michael’s change of heart and questioned him until he played the recording he made of Marty (Michael E. Knight) confessing that he called the SEC at Nina’s behest. Nina correctly assumed that Michael coerced Michael into getting Marty to betray attorney-client privilege, but she knew he hadn’t told Sonny yet.
Nina also correctly pointed out that she didn’t do anything illegal by reporting a crime, unlike Michael’s mother, who committed an actual crime. Nina asked to know what Michael wanted from her. Michael’s demands were simple in Michael’s mind. He would control when she could see Willow and Wiley, plus Nina would have to sell her share of the Metro Court back to Carly.
Nina was horrified at the thought but then outraged when Michael told her she wasn’t going to get off so easy for turning in two people who committed a crime. That statement infuriated Nina and she lashed out at Michael, pointing out how easy Carly (Laura Wright) got off by keeping both of her adult children from her just because she felt like it.
In a glorious speech that was a long time coming, Nina told Michael straight out that what she did to Carly and Drew (Cameron Mathison) was nothing compared to what Carly did to her and nobody was going to keep her away from her daughter ever again.
She admitted turning Nina and Drew in was an impulsive move, but she’d explain it to Willow. Michael was unfazed as he pointed out how much Drew meant to his wife. In Michael’s mind, there was no way Willow would ever forgive her for putting Drew behind bars. He also warned her that the truth would end her new marriage to Sonny.
Willow Reunited With Liesl
General Hospital – Willow and Liesl
Over at GH, Willow was happy to be with family when Aunt Liesl (Katheen Gati) paid her a visit. She spent the last few months at a spa rejuvenating herself after a difficult year and hoped Willow and Nina would join her there one day. Willow said she wasn’t sure Nina would want to go on a vacation without Sonny now that they were married. It turned out this marriage was news to Liesl.
Liesl was furious to hear other people were at the elopement but not her. Then, it dawned on her that Willow actually attended her mother’s wedding and she was thrilled that they were growing closer. Willow even admitted that life couldn’t be better at the moment.
Sonny Did Carly A Big Favor
Sonny and Brick (Stephen A. Smith) sat in his office and discussed the fact that Cyrus (Jeff Kober) had been released from jail. Sonny was sure he was the person blackmailing Ava and wanted this problem taken care of. He needed to figure out what Cyrus would do next.
Soon, Carly stopped in freaked out that Drew wasn’t allowed any visitors. She needed Sonny’s help to find out what was going on over at Pentonville. Sonny was able to learn that Drew was in solitary confinement for his own protection.
Sasha Decided To Stay In Port Charles
General Hospital – Oct 25 – Sasha
Dante (Dominic Zamprogna) dropped by the Q stables to check up on Cody (Josh Kelly) and make sure he still had a job. Cody was happy to report that Olivia (Lisa LoCicero) wouldn’t allow him to be fired just for helping Sasha (Sofia Mattsson) out of a serious jam. When Dante mentioned that Sasha would be happy to know this, Cody said that Sasha was probably already gone.
Dante admitted he tried to talk Sasha out of leaving, but it was to no avail. Dante understood why Sasha would want to start fresh somewhere else. Still, Dante knew that Cody had feelings for Sasha or he wouldn’t have done all that he did for her.
The subject then turned to Mac. Dante advised his friend to just tell Mac the truth already so he’d know they were father and son. Obviously, Cody wanted Mac to find out since he recently confessed to Sasha and Sam. Dante pointed out that Mac believed in him and had a right to know the truth.
After Dante left, Cody had a one-sided chat with Comet about his life before Sasha appeared at the door. She wasn’t leaving after all. The timing was perfect because Maxie (Kirsten Storms) had just ordered Lucy (Lynn Herring) to call her and ask her to remain the Face of Deception.
Trina Moved Ava To Tears
General Hospital – Ava
Ava (Maura West) and Trina (Tabyana Ali) met up for coffee and Trina was horrified to learn what happened to Ava. She couldn’t lose her as she was a second mother and wanted to know what really happened, but Ava dodged her questions.
The subject turned to Trina’s New York trip. Trina thanked Ava for making it even more special by introducing her to the world of art. Thanks to Ava, she was able to have an immersive experience at the Metropolitan Museum of Art, as well as a romantic weekend with Spencer (Nicholas Alexander Chavez).
The whole talk brought Ava to tears as she explained there weren’t many people in her life who cared about her. She was grateful to have Trina because she loved her with no agenda in mind.
